{{ liveTime }}
{{ liveDate }}
MES / ÜRETİM TAKİP SİSTEMİ
{{ stations.length }}
İstasyon
{{ orders.length }}
Sipariş
{{ totalSteps }}
Operasyon Adımı
{{ completedOrdersCount }}
Tamamlanan İş
{{ overdueCount }}
Gecikmeli
Gecikmeli
Gecikme yok
{{ o.deadline }}
Aktif İş Emirleri
Henüz sipariş yok
{{ o.id }}
{{ orderOverallPct(o.id) }}%
Sistem Durumu
İstasyon
{{ stations.length }}
Toplam Adım
{{ totalSteps }}
Malzeme Tanımı
{{ altMamuller.length }}
BOM Reçete
{{ bomCards.length }}
Eksik Malzeme
{{ missingMaterialCount }}
SİSTEM AKTİF
{{ liveTime }}
İstasyonlar & Adımlar
Bağlantı Tanımları
{{ subProducts.length }}
Malzeme Listesi
{{ altMamuller.length }}
İstasyon & Adım Yönetimi
Henüz istasyon yok. Yeni istasyon ekleyin.
{{ si+1 }}.
{{ station.name }}
{{ station.steps.length }} adım
{{ stationDoneCount(si, selectedOrderId) }}/{{ station.steps.length }}
{{ stepi+1 }}.
{{ step }}
Alt Mamül Yönetimi
Henüz alt mamül yok. Yeni alt mamül ekleyin.
{{ sp.name }}
Bağlı İstasyon / Adımlar
{{ lnk.stationName }} › {{ lnk.stepName }}
Henüz bağlantı yok
Bağlantı Ekle
İstasyon
Adım
Malzeme Listesi (Alt Mamul Tanımları)
Bu listede tanımlanan malzemeler BOM List sayfasında reçetelere ve
Veri Girişi sayfasında Alt Malzeme seçimine gelir.
İş emrine özel veya genel malzeme tanımlayabilirsiniz.
Henüz malzeme tanımı yok. Yeni malzeme ekleyin.
İş Emri Yönetimi
{{ grp }}
{{ status==='inprogress'?'Üretimde':status==='critical'?'Kritik':status==='onhold'?'Beklemede':status==='closed'?'Kapalı':status==='open'?'Açık':'Teslim' }}
{{ orderSearch ? 'Eşleşen sipariş bulunamadı.' : 'Henüz sipariş yok.' }}
{{ order.id }}
{{ order.status==='closed'?'KAPALI':order.status==='inprogress'?'DEVAM':order.status==='onhold'?'BEKLEMEDE':order.status==='delivered'?'TESLİM':'AÇIK' }}
{{ order.orderType==='urgent'?'ACİL':order.orderType==='sample'?'NUMUNE':order.orderType==='revision'?'REVİZYON':'STANDART' }}
{{ order.customer }}
{{ order.qty }} adet
{{ order.deadline || '—' }}
GECİKMELİ
{{ order.createdAt }}
{{ order.unitPrice }} {{ order.currency }}
{{ order.technicalSpec }}
ÜRETİM İLERLEME
{{ orderOverallPct(order.id) }}%
{{ planPage }} / {{ planTotalPages }}
({{ filteredOrders.length }} sipariş)
Veri Girişi
Termin: {{ selectedOrder.deadline || '—' }}
GECİKMELİ
{{ overallPct }}% Tamamlandı
Yukarıdan bir sipariş seçin.
| Operasyon Adımı | Durum | Alt Mlzm | Baş. Tarih | Baş. Saat | Bit. Tarih | Bit. Saat | Hedef (s) | Gerçek (s) | Sapma (s) |
|---|---|---|---|---|---|---|---|---|---|
|
{{ station.name }}
{{ stationDoneCount(si, selectedOrderId) }} / {{ activeStepCount(selectedOrderId, si) }} tamamlandı
TÜM ADIMLAR
|
|||||||||
| {{ stepi+1 }}. {{ step }} |
|
{{ calcActual(si,stepi,selectedOrderId) !== null ? calcActual(si,stepi,selectedOrderId).toFixed(2) : '—' }} | {{ calcDeviation(si,stepi,selectedOrderId)>0 ? '+' : '' }}{{ calcDeviation(si,stepi,selectedOrderId).toFixed(2) }} — | ||||||
Dashboard
⚠ GECİKMELİ
Dashboard için sipariş seçin.
{{ overallPct }}%
Genel Tamamlanma
{{ selectedOrder?.deadline || '—' }}
Termin Tarihi
{{ totalDoneSteps }}
Tamamlanan Adım
{{ totalSteps - totalDoneSteps }}
Kalan Adım
{{ totalMaterialNeeded }}
Toplam Malzeme İhtiyacı
{{ selectedOrderPresentMaterial }}
Temin Edilen Malzeme
{{ selectedOrderMissingMaterial }}
Eksik Malzeme
Şu An Aktif Adım
{{ currentStepLabel }}
İstasyon Bazında İlerleme
Sipariş Bilgileri
Müşteri
{{ selectedOrder?.customer }}
Sipariş No
{{ selectedOrder?.id }}
Ürün / Açıklama
{{ selectedOrder?.product || '—' }}
Sipariş Adedi
{{ selectedOrder?.qty }} adet
Termin Tarihi
{{ selectedOrder?.deadline || '—' }}
GECİKMELİ
Süre Sapma Özeti
{{ totalPositiveDeviation }}
Gecikme (s)
{{ totalNegativeDeviation }}
Önde (s)
Timeline
Timeline için sipariş seçin.
{{ si+1 }}
{{ stationPct(si) }}%
{{ station.name }}
{{ station.name }}
{{ stationPct(si) }}%
Başlangıç
{{ stationStartDate(si) || '—' }}
Bitiş
{{ stationEndDate(si) || '—' }}
Geçen Süre
{{ stationElapsed(si) }}
Kalan Süre
{{ stationRemaining(si) }}
{{ stepi+1 }}. {{ step }}
▶ {{ getEntry(si,stepi).startDate }}
■ {{ getEntry(si,stepi).endDate }}
Alt Malzeme Durumu
{{ missingMaterialCount }} Eksik
{{ presentMaterialCount }} Mevcut
Henüz sipariş yok.
{{ order.id }}
{{ order.customer }}
— {{ order.product }}
{{ orderMissingCount(order.id) }} Eksik
{{ orderPresentCount(order.id) }} Mevcut
{{ orderNoMaterialCount(order.id) }} Belirsiz
İstasyon / Adım
Adım Durumu
Alt Malzeme
{{ station.name }}
{{ stepi+1 }}. {{ step }}
{{ getEntry(si,stepi,order.id).done ? '✓ Tamamlandı' : '⏳ Bekliyor' }}
{{ getEntry(si,stepi,order.id).hasMaterial ? 'MEVCUT' : 'EKSİK' }}
BOM List — İş Emri Reçeteleri
YENİ BOM KARTI
{{ orders.find(o=>o.id===bomForm.orderId)?.customer || '—' }}
⚠ Önce Parametreler → Alt Mamul bölümünden alt mamul tanımlayın
⚠ Bu iş emrine ait alt mamul yok. Parametreler'den ekleyin veya iş emri seçimini kaldırın.
⚠ {{ bomFormErr }}
Aktif İstasyonlar
Bu iş emrinde hangi istasyonlar ve adımlar kullanılacak?
{{ station.name }}
{{ activeStepCount(bomForm.orderId, si) }}/{{ station.steps.length }}
Henüz BOM kartı yok. Soldan yeni kart ekleyin.
{{ orderId }}
{{ orders.find(o=>o.id===orderId)?.customer || '?' }}
{{ bomCards.filter(b=>b.orderId===orderId).length }} kalem
{{ getActiveStationCount(orderId) }} aktif istasyon
| İSTASYON | OPERASYON ADIMI | ALT MAMUL | MİKTAR | NOT | |
|---|---|---|---|---|---|
| {{ card.stationName }} | {{ card.stepName }} | {{ card.materialName }} | {{ card.qty }} {{ card.unit }} | {{ card.note || '—' }} |
Uluslararası Rota Simülasyonu
SİMÜLASYON HIZI:
{{ simCurrentTimeStr }}
{{ fromCity ? fromCity.label : '' }} → {{ toCity ? toCity.label : '' }}
{{ simRunning ? '▶ ÇALIŞIYOR' : simDone ? '✓ TAMAMLANDI' : '⏸ DURDU' }}
🚛
{{ ms.label }}
Seyahat Logu
{{ entry.time }}
{{ entry.msg }}
Ulaşım Raporu — {{ fromCity ? fromCity.label : '' }} → {{ toCity ? toCity.label : '' }}
{{ simReport.totalKm }}
Toplam Mesafe (km)
{{ simReport.driveHours }}
Aktif Sürüş (saat)
{{ simReport.restHours }}
Kısa Molalar (saat)
{{ simReport.sleepHours }}
Günlük Dinlenme (saat)
{{ simReport.totalHours }}
Toplam Süre (saat)
{{ simReport.avgSpeed }}
Ort. Hız (km/h)
{{ simReport.borderCrossings }}
Sınır Geçişi
{{ simReport.fuelEstimate }} L
Yakıt Tahmini
{{ simReport.days }}
Sürüş Günü
Uygulanan Mevzuat (EC 561/2006)
🚛 Maks. TIR hızı (otoyol): 90 km/h
☕ 4.5s sürüş → zorunlu mola: 45 dakika
🛌 Günlük min. dinlenme: 11 saat
📅 Günlük maks. sürüş: 9 saat
🛂 Sınır geçiş bekleme: ~2 saat/sınır
⛽ Yakıt tüketimi (TIR): ~35 L/100km
Veri Yönetimi
DIŞA AKTAR
Tüm verileri (istasyonlar, siparişler, veri girişleri) JSON formatında dışa aktarın.
İÇE AKTAR
JSON yedeğini geri yükleyin. Mevcut veriler tamamen değiştirilir.
CSV AKTAR
Seçili siparişin tüm veri girişlerini Excel/CSV formatında dışa aktarın.
Veri Özeti
İstasyonlar
{{ stations.length }}
Toplam Adım
{{ totalSteps }}
Siparişler
{{ orders.length }}
Veri Kayıtları
{{ Object.keys(entryData).length }}
TEHLİKE BÖLGESİ
Fabrika verilerini varsayılana sıfırlar. Bu işlem geri alınamaz.
{{ t.msg }}